Abstract
Event service is an asynchronous communication model between interacting parties, e.g. autonomic functions (AFs), instead of a tightly coupled point-to-point (P2P) synchronous communication model. Event service enables autonomic nodes in ANI to publish data information, which will be made network distributable autonomously, and subscribers who register interests to specific events will be notified if the information is available. This draft describes how to support event service (ES) for autonomic networking.
